Electronic properties of normal and superconducting alkali fullerides probed byC13nuclear magnetic resonance

Abstract
We report the results of C13 NMR measurements on K3 C60 and Rb3 C60 in the normal and superconducting states. Electronic densities of states at the Fermi energy in the normal-state and energy gaps in the superconducting state are estimated from spin-lattice-relaxation data. Implications of the relaxation and spectral data for the electronic properties of these materials are discussed.
